Dear all!
Myself and my colaborators have 2 USRP2+WBX boards. We use them in the
500-700 MHz band. 
The boards worked just fine  until today, when we have used a stronger input
signal generated by an Agilent signal generator connected directly via
cable. The generated signal, a 2 MHz - large wideband signal had a maximum
power of -16 dBm which was never exceeded. Most probably after using this
signal, the board started to have problems, the sensibility being now much
lower. We are forced now to raise the gain of the board to the maximum
factor allowed (31.5) in order to see some valid signal at the input. 
The SNR ratio seems to be the same, but the signals which we previously
detected with an external antenna around -40 dBm have now a level around -80
dBm. We never tried to use the board as a transmitter so we don't know if
the problem is also on the TX branch.
We would really appreciate any time of hint or tip regarding this problem.
Also is there a general hardware reset, except the power off?
